Egypt, Senegal Explore Launch of Alexandria–Dakar Maritime Route
Egypt and Senegal are exploring the establishment of a commercial maritime shipping route linking the ports of Alexandria and Dakar as part of efforts to expand trade and deepen cooperation in the maritime transport sector.
The Egyptian government, in cooperation with the Senegalese side, is studying the launching of a maritime hotline linking the ports of Alexandria and Dakar, as well as the promotion of joint cooperation in the manufacture of fishing vessels and boats and the development of maritime infrastructure, in support of trade and investment between the two countries.
